Joel Martino has been competing for 7 years. His best event is the 3×3: a personal-best single of 14.54, set at PSKG Premiere Cubing 2020, puts him in the top 22.9% of the 284,439 people who have ever been ranked in the event, and 1,128th in Indonesia. Across 3 competitions since July 2019, he has put 54 official solves on the record across six events. His 3×3 best has come down from 23.57 in July 2019 to 14.54, a 38% improvement. Joel has entered three competitions, more competitions than 69% of everyone who has ever competed.
